Está en la página 1de 19

Solución de sistemas de ecuaciones

Solución de sistemas de ecuaciones

Dr. José Carlos Zamarripa Rodrı́guez

Universidad Tecnológica de México


Solución de sistemas de ecuaciones

Método de Gauss
El método de Gauss consiste en considerar un sistema de ecuaciones de
la forma
a11 x1 + a12 x2 + · · · + a1n xn = b1 (1)
a21 x1 + a22 x2 + · · · + a2n xn = b2 (2)
..
. (3)
an1 x1 + an2 x2 + · · · + ann xn = bn (4)
y reescribirlo en términos de una matriz extendida de la forma
 
a11 a12 · · · a1n b1
 
 a21 a22 · · · a2n b2 
(5)
 
 .. 
 . 
 
an1 an2 · · · ann bn
para posteriormente realizar las operaciones elementales necesarias para
buscar tener unos en la diagonal y ceros debajo de la diagonal.
Solución de sistemas de ecuaciones

Método de Gauss

Operaciones elementales por renglones


Multiplicar o dividir un renglón por un número diferente de cero
Sumar un múltiplo de un renglón a otro renglón
Intercambiar renglones
Notación
1 Ri → cRi quiere decir remplaza el i-esimo renglon por ese mismo
renglón multiplicado por un número c
2 Rj → Rj + cRi significa sustituye el j-esimo renglón por la suma del
renglón j mas el renglón i multiplicado por c.
Solución de sistemas de ecuaciones

Método de Gauss
El método de Gauss consiste en considerar un sistema de ecuaciones de
la forma
a11 x1 + a12 x2 + · · · + a1n xn = b1 (6)
a21 x1 + a22 x2 + · · · + a2n xn = b2 (7)
..
. (8)
an1 x1 + an2 x2 + · · · + ann xn = bn (9)
y reescribirlo en términos de una matriz extendida de la forma
 
a11 a12 · · · a1n b1
 
 a21 a22 · · · a2n b2 
(10)
 
 .. 
 . 
 
an1 an2 · · · ann bn
para posteriormente realizar las operaciones elementales necesarias para
buscar tener unos en la diagonal y ceros debajo de la diagonal.
Solución de sistemas de ecuaciones

Ejemplo método de Gauss


Encuentra la solución al sistema de ecuaciones

2x + 4y + 6z = 18 (11)
4x + 5y + 6z = 24 (12)
3x + y − 2z = 4 (13)

Lo primero que haremos será escribir el sistema en la forma de matriz


extendida
2 4 6 18
 
 
 4 5 6 24  (14)
 
3 1 −2 4
1
Ahora lo que haremos será R1 → 2 R1

2 4 6 18 1 2 3 9 1 2 3 9
     
R1 → 1 R1 R2 →R2 −2R1
  2    
 4
 5 6 24 
 −→  4
 5 6 24 
 −→  0
 −3 −6 −12 

3 1 −2 4 3 1 −2 4 3 1 −2 4
(15)
Solución de sistemas de ecuaciones

1 2 3 9 1 2 3 9 1 2 3 9
    
R2 →R3 −3R1 R2 → −1 R2
    3 
 0
 −3 −6 −12 
 −→  0
 −3 −6 −12 
 −→  0
 1 2 4

3 1 −2 4 0 −5 −11 −23 0 −5 −11 −23

1 2 3 9 1 2 3 9
   
R3 →R3 +5R2   R3 →−R3  
−→  0
 1 2 4 
 −→  0
 1 2 4 

0 0 −1 −3 0 0 1 3

de este modo ahora sabemos que z = 3 y con esto podemos sustituir en la ecuación dos

y + 2(3) = 4
y = −2 (17)

y finalmente

x + 2(−2) + 3(3) = 9
x = 3 (18)
Solución de sistemas de ecuaciones

Método de Gauss-Jordan

El método de Gauss-Jordan consiste en exactamente lo mismo que el


método de Gauss solo que una vez que hemos hecho ceros a los números
de bajo de la diagonal en la matriz se busca también hacer cero por
arriba de la diagonal.
Solución de sistemas de ecuaciones

Ejemplo método de Gauss-Jordan

Sigamos con el mismo ejemplo del caso anterior y partamos desde el


sistema
1 2 3 9 1 0 −1 1 1 0 −1 1
     
  R1 →R1 −2R2   R2 →R2 −2R3  
 0
 1 2 4 
 −→  0
 1 2 4 
 −→  0
 1 0 −2 

0 0 1 3 0 0 1 3 0 0 1 3

1 0 0 4
 
R1 →R1 +R3  
−→  0
 1 0 −2 

0 0 1 3
de este modo se obtiene que x = 4, y = −2 y z = 3
Solución de sistemas de ecuaciones

Ejercicios

2x − y + 3z = 8
5x + 8y − 3z = −1
2x − 5y + 9z = 20 (20)

3x − y + 2z = −1
2x + 3y + z = 2
−4x + 2y − z = 7 (21)
Solución de sistemas de ecuaciones

Método de la inversa

Por álgebra lineal se sabe que un sistema de ecuaciones lineales es posible


reescrbirlo de manera
Ax̄ = b̄ (22)
donde A = (aij ), x̄ es el vector de incognitas y b̄ el vector dado por la
igualdad. Ahora bien si det(A) ̸= 0 entonces A es invertible y por tanto
de la ec (22) se sigue

A−1 Ax̄ = A−1 b̄ (23)


−1
I x̄ = A b̄ (24)
x̄ = A−1 b̄ (25)

por lo tanto el método de la inversa consiste en determinar la inversa y


después multiplicar la por el vector b̄
Solución de sistemas de ecuaciones

Ejemplo (solución de un sistema de ecuaciones por la inversas)


Soluciona el sistema de ecuaciones

2x − y = 3 (26)
3x + y = −1 (27)
" #
2 −1
 
x
Para este caso tenemos que A = y los vectores x = y
3 1 y
 
3
b= .
−1
 1 1

−1 5 5
Sabemos que A = , de este modo tenemos la solución
− 53 25
" #

x
  1 1

3
 2/5
−1 5 5
= A = = (28)
y − 35 2
5
−1 − 11
5
Solución de sistemas de ecuaciones

ejercicios

8x − 3y + 5z = −3 (29)
2x + 7y + 3z = 2 (30)
x + 6y − 9z = 5 (31)

7x − 2y + 3z = 8 (32)
3x − 8y + z = 6 (33)
2x − 3y + 6z = 7 (34)
Solución de sistemas de ecuaciones

Método de Jacobi
Consideremos un sistema de ecuaciones lineal de la forma

Ax̄ = b̄ (35)

El método de Jacobi consiste en suponer que la matriz A se puede


separar en la forma
A=L+D +U (36)
donde L es una matriz triangular inferior con ceros en la diagonal, D es
una matriz diagonal y U es una matriz superior con ceros en la
diagonal.De este modo al sustituir (36) en la ecuación (35)

x̄ = D −1 (b̄ − (L + U)x̄) (37)

esta es la ecuación que describe el método de Jacobi, que de manera


iterada se puede escribir

x̄ (k) = D −1 (b̄ − (L + U)x̄ (k−1) ) (38)


Solución de sistemas de ecuaciones

Ejemplo
Encuentre el vector solución en la tercera del siguiente sistema de
ecuaciones usando fix 5

10x + y + z = 24
−x + 20y + z = 21
x − 2y + 100z = 300 (39)

donde tenemos el vector inicial x 0 = 0̄


Usando el método de Jacobi llegamos a la ecuación vectorial
 k   24−y k−1 −z k−1 
x 10
k−1 k−1
 yk  =   21+x 20−z

 (40)
k k−1 k−1
z 300−x +2y
100
Solución de sistemas de ecuaciones

De manera iterada se obtienen las aproximaciones del vector solución


0 1 2 3
x 0 2.4 1.995 1.9983
y 0 1.05 1.02 0.9999
z 0 3 2.997 3.00045
Solución de sistemas de ecuaciones

Método de Gauss-Seidel

Este método nace de acelerar el método de Jacobi, por ende es


exactamente el mismo método salvo por una modificación, esto se logra
incorporando la información de la variable recién calculada en la siguiente
ecuación, matemáticamente esto se escribe en la forma
 
x̄ (k) = D −1 b̄ − Lx̄ (k) − U x̄ (k−1) . (41)

donde recordemos que k no denota una potencia, sino el número de la


iteración.
Solución de sistemas de ecuaciones

Ejemplo
Encuentre el vector solución en la tercera del siguiente sistema de
ecuaciones usando fix 5

10x + y + z = 24
−x + 20y + z = 21
x − 2y + 100z = 300 (42)

donde tenemos el vector inicial x 0 = 0̄


Usando el método de Gauss-Seidel llegamos a la ecuación vectorial
 k   24−y k−1 −z k−1 
x 10
k k−1
 yk  =   21+x 20−z

 (43)
k k k
z 300−x +2y
100
Solución de sistemas de ecuaciones

Ejemplo Gauss-Seidel

n x y z
0 0 0 0
1 2.4 1.17 2.9994
2 1.98306 0.99918 3.00015
3 2.00007 1 3
4 2 1 3
5 2 1 3
Solución de sistemas de ecuaciones

ejercicios

8x − 3y + 5z = −3 (44)
2x + 7y + 3z = 2 (45)
x + 6y − 9z = 5 (46)

⃗ (0) = (0.05, 0.5, −0.2)


Con el vector inicial X
2

7x − 2y + 3z = 8 (47)
3x − 8y + z = 6 (48)
2x − 3y + 6z = 7 (49)

⃗ (0) = (1, 0.5, 1)


Con el vector inicial X

También podría gustarte